Enhanced SIRT6 activity abrogates the neurotoxic phenotype of astrocytes expressing ALS-linked mutant SOD1

Sirtuins (SIRTs) are NAD(+)-dependent deacylases that play a key role in transcription, DNA repair, metabolism, and oxidative stress resistance.
